Angels

"Speak of angels;

You shall hear their wings"

Is what I'm starting to believe

Because everytime your name is mentioned

I feel a fluttering over my shoulder

And then I see you standing there

Smiling so innocently.

Hand in hand we go running off--

Is this what it's like to be carefree?

Kissing me and holding me tight;

Maybe our differences don't make

That much of a difference.

Reaching out my hand,

I'm willing to take this chance

Because your innocent face

And guiltless manner have

Captured something inside me.

You really are so sweet.

Maybe I'm a little devil,

But I'm willing to put all that aside

For a taste of what you bring to me.

I speak of angels and

I hear your wings.
